What Is a Casino Online?

A casino online is a gambling website that offers players the opportunity to play real money games. These sites use advanced encryption technology to protect the personal and financial information of their players. In addition, they offer secure banking options and customer support to assist players. Some of the most popular casino online games include poker, slots, and table games.

Most online casinos have a welcome bonus that gives players free money when they sign up. This bonus may be in the form of a match on their initial deposit or free spins on online slots. These bonuses are designed to attract new customers and reward loyal ones. However, these bonuses come with terms and conditions that must be met before the player can withdraw any winnings.

In addition to free spins, many online casinos also offer other promotions and bonuses that can be used to increase a player’s bankroll or win prizes. These include loyalty rewards, free spins on slot machines, and casino tournaments. Many of these promotions are exclusive to players of certain casino games, but others are available to all players.

The most common method of payment for an online casino is a credit card. You can choose from MasterCard, Visa, Discover, American Express, and more. Some casinos even accept c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in. The choice is yours, but be sure to read the casino’s privacy policy and security standards before you choose a payment method.
